....This is a baby Prairie Rattlesnake ...they are born live and venomous .....They do produce a potent venom with neurotoxic and hemotoxic properties, which kills the prey and also helps with the digestion by destroying tissue. Some populations of the prairie rattler are thought to possess the infamous "Mojave toxin" like their relative the Mojave rattlesnake. Photographed in the Wichita Mountains of Oklahoma.
